Understanding the Role of Vitamins in Skin and Hair Health

Your skin and hair are basically living proof of what's happening inside your body. When you're missing key vitamins, it shows up as dull skin, brittle nails, or hair that just won't cooperate. The good news? The right vitamins can transform your beauty game from the inside out.

Essential Vitamins for Skin Health

Your skin craves certain vitamins to stay plump, glowing, and healthy. Vitamin C is your collagen's best mate, helping your skin bounce back and look fresh. Meanwhile, vitamin E benefits include acting as a powerful shield against environmental damage—think of it as your skin's personal bodyguard. Don't sleep on Vitamin A either; it's brilliant for cell turnover and keeping your complexion smooth.

Key Vitamins for Hair Growth and Strength

When it comes to hair that actually grows and doesn't break at the first sign of humidity, certain vitamins are non-negotiable. Biotin benefits are legendary for a reason—this B-vitamin helps create stronger, thicker strands. Vitamin D keeps your hair follicles happy and productive, while the entire B complex family works together to support natural hair growth cycles.

Step 3: Optimising Your Diet for Skin and Hair Health

Supplements are fab, but real food is where the magic happens. Your diet should be doing most of the heavy lifting when it comes to getting vitamins for skin and hair. Plus, your body absorbs nutrients from food way better than from pills alone.

Foods Rich in Skin-Boosting Vitamins

Citrus fruits are vitamin C powerhouses that'll help your skin produce collagen naturally. Nuts and seeds pack serious vitamin E punch, perfect for protecting your skin from daily damage. Sweet potatoes are loaded with vitamin A, which helps your skin repair and renew itself whilst you sleep.

Hair-Healthy Food Choices

Eggs are basically biotin bombs that'll make your hair stronger from root to tip. Fatty fish like salmon deliver omega-3s that keep your scalp healthy and your hair shiny. Leafy greens provide iron, which your hair follicles need to function properly and support consistent growth.

Step 4: Topical Application of Vitamin-Rich Products

Why not attack from both angles? Whilst you're feeding your skin and hair from the inside, topical vitamin products can deliver targeted benefits exactly where you need them. It's like giving your beauty routine a double boost.

Vitamin-Infused Skincare Products

Vitamin C serums are brilliant for brightening and protecting your skin during the day. Vitamin E creams work wonders for deep moisturising, especially after sun exposure. Retinol products (that's vitamin A in skincare form) are your go-to for smoothing texture and preventing premature ageing.

Haircare Products with Vital Nutrients

Biotin-enriched shampoos can support your hair from the outside whilst you work on nutrition from within. Vitamin E hair oils are perfect for sealing moisture and adding shine to dry ends. Leave-in treatments packed with multiple vitamins give your hair ongoing nourishment throughout the day.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the best vitamins for glowing skin?

Vitamin C, E, and A are your skin's holy trinity. Vitamin C boosts collagen production for plump, bouncy skin. Vitamin E acts as an antioxidant shield against damage. Vitamin A helps with cell turnover for smoother texture. Biotin also supports healthy skin alongside its hair benefits.

How long does it take to see results from hair and skin vitamins?

Most people start noticing changes in their skin within 4-6 weeks, whilst hair improvements can take 8-12 weeks since hair grows slowly. Remember, consistency is key—taking vitamins sporadically won't give you the results you want.

Can I take multiple vitamin supplements together?

Generally yes, but some vitamins can interfere with others' absorption. For example, calcium can block iron absorption. It's best to space them out throughout the day or consult with a healthcare professional about the best timing for your specific combination.

Are there any side effects of taking vitamins for skin and hair?

Most people tolerate vitamins well, but taking too much of certain vitamins (especially fat-soluble ones like A, D, E, and K) can cause problems. Some people experience stomach upset with certain supplements. Always stick to recommended doses and consult a healthcare professional if you experience any unusual symptoms.
